Bunbury detectives are investigating an assault at a tavern in Kirup that has left a man in a critical condition.
Police said an altercation occurred between two men at a tavern on the Western Highway last Friday, resulting in a 56 year old male receiving serious head injuries.
He is currently at RPH in a critical condition.
Detectives would like to speak to a man in his 20s who they believe may be able to assist them with their inquiries.
The man is described as fair skinned with a muscular build.
The July 14 altercation happened between 8:30 and 9:30pm.
